I want to speak for everyone and say there needs to be more difficult tasks that will push teams to the limits (but not overboard like jumping over sharks) and make them interact with the natural surrounding culture such as communicating with locals, common sense, trial-error, and make them critically think for themselves like in the pioneer seasons rather than just navigation and counting on taxis. For example, the season 2 premiere in Rio required teams to figure out how to rent a boat to get themselves to a ship in the middle of Guanabara Bay. A while back in season 14, teams had choices to travel from Los Angeles to Locarno, Switzerland via a flight to Milan OR Zurich and then taking the train from there to the church. I enjoyed those unpredictable moments and hope they are brought back to all versions of TAR.

Also, cryptic clues like in the finale of season 17 (Don Quixote/7 Year Itch - Quixote Studios Stage 7) made the broadcast a lot more fun as well as engaging the racers to be clever.

Quote from: Jimmer
Greenland and Antarctica are safe and there are things that can be done. Also, I don't think it's that big of a deal that Greenland only connects to Europe. TAR has done many Europe --> Africa --> Europe. TAR12 and 17 come to mind that have. What's the difference in doing Europe --> Greenland --> Europe?

Europe-Africa-Europe is one thing since they were flying to and from different destinations and had legs in Africa in the process (even though in TAR 12 they connected in CDG both ways lol).

Europe-Greenland-Europe basically forces teams to stay on Greenland an extra day so Phil can fly back out, especially if the following leg isn't in Iceland (which...wouldn't make sense if they're already going to Greenland) or Copenhagen (which is feasible!). It's a waste of time IMO unless they can manage two legs in Greenland which if so, more power to them. There are ways to do this, namely-

Quote from: ianthebalance
Greenland wouldn't be too hard if it was the second to last leg. Just have the previous leg in Europe, connect via Reykjavik, and for the final leg, connect to a city with a non-stop flight via Reykjavik.

This is probably the best idea though in checking it looks like the flights from Greenland to Iceland are 2x per week (Monday and Thursday / Friday depending on the city). It's doable but they pretty much are planning the race around said flight (wouldn't be the first time I imagine  :snicker:)

Quote from: Platrium
How about having Greenland for 1st or 2nd leg? I think it'll work too.

My thinking is that in order to get to Greenland for leg 1, they would have to connect through Copenhagen or, if lucky, Iceland or possibly NE Canada from Iqalquit but
1. these flights are EXPENSIVE and
2. why not just have a leg in Iceland or Iqalquit which would be cheaper and/or easier to reach?

For the record I'm #teamicelandaspenultimateleg. Give the teams a car with 4x4 drive and let them have at it. :)
